Tour the Family Farm Museum to learn about seasonal tools used on farms from the 1700’s to the 1900’s. 

Take a wagon ride through our scenic 300 acres and help support the Friends of Springton Manor Farm. This non-profit group is dedicated to recreation, education, conservation, and preservation of the Farm, and will share information about volunteering at the park.

This year we are excited to host our very first Cinco-de-Mayo Block Party First Friday at Oxford Feed and Lumber on Friday, May 1st 2026 from 5:00-8:00pm.

We are going to be celebrating the Mexican Army’s victory over the French in the Battle of Puebla with good food, community, Mariachi music, and fun! This free event begins at 5:00pm and ends at 8:00pm. Come hungry! There will be food trucks at this event, but don’t forget to stop by Taquiera Los Juarez to grab some delicious Mexican food and a margarita!

Imagination Street a new play space that kids and parents can enjoy together. For kids (ages 0–9), it is a meaningful, hands-on play experience in nine, interactive, themed playhouses that form a “city” to explore. For parents, there’s a cafe-style lounge to gather, drink coffee, or get some work done. Because the space is an open concept, parents are in close proximity of their children the entire time. They offer open play sessions, private parties, events, and more.
